Alter Ego is a logic platformer by Shiru, Kulor and Denis Grachev. You have to switch between them the hero and his alter ego to clear levels. It is a bit similar to the game Binary Land.

This game is a remake of recent ZX Spectrum game of the same name. The original version created by Denis Grachev from RetroSouls, you can see video of it here and get it here. NES version got new graphics, original music by Kulor (composed for the game), and some other changes.

Interesting technical feature of this game is that it is written in C, with cc65 compiler. You can get source code here. More details about this and development process in general are available in notes.txt file provided with the game.

Alter Ego by Shiru, Kulor, Denis Grachev